Artsmark Celebration Week is back

This academic year’s Celebration Week took place from Monday 10 to Friday 14 November 2025. 

During the week we shone a light on how Artsmark is transforming schools across the country, and celebrated the amazing creativity of children and young people. This year was all about connections.  

  • How does Artsmark connect you as a school?
  • How does the arts connect you to parents, carers and your local community?
  • What impact have your connections with arts and cultural organisations or freelancers had?
  • How do you connect with other Artsmark schools?  

Schools got involve in a number of ways - hosting a celebration event, a special assembly, a whole arts week or a day dedicated to creativity. We encouraged schools to invite their local MP or the media along to join in the celebrations! 

Schools were able to invite us along via this form if they wanted a member of our team to visit one of their events - please do continue to invite us throughout the year, not just Celebration Week.

We provided resources to help schools and cultural organisations shout from the rooftops about the impact Artsmark has had on their pupils and school community.
